Автор |
Сообщение |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 14/09/2017 11:26:28
|
AlKuz
Зарегистрирован: 14/09/2017 11:01:56
Сообщений: 4
Оффлайн
|
Здравствуйте!
Помогите пожалуйста разобраться с проблемой. При отправке запроса на регистрацию результатов инвентаризации получаю ошибку: "Запрос должен содержать заявку". Примеры запроса и ответа во вложении. Работаю с тестовой системой. С api@vetrf.ru никакого ответа так и не получил, поэтому пишу сюда.
Имя файла |
InventoryRequest.txt |
Загрузить
|
Описание |
|
Размер файла |
3 Kbytes
|
Скачано: |
522 раз |
Имя файла |
InventoryResponse.txt |
Загрузить
|
Описание |
|
Размер файла |
802 bytes
|
Скачано: |
507 раз |
Это сообщение было редактировано 1 раз. Последнее обновление произошло в 14/09/2017 11:27:01
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 14/09/2017 14:12:01
|
nsnt
Зарегистрирован: 31/05/2017 09:06:10
Сообщений: 242
Оффлайн
|
AlKuz wrote:Здравствуйте!
Помогите пожалуйста разобраться с проблемой. При отправке запроса на регистрацию результатов инвентаризации получаю ошибку: "Запрос должен содержать заявку". Примеры запроса и ответа во вложении. Работаю с тестовой системой. С api@vetrf.ru никакого ответа так и не получил, поэтому пишу сюда.
Возможно, потому что в stockDiscrepancy/resultingList/stockEntry требуется указать uuid, а не guid.
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 14/09/2017 15:09:04
|
AlKuz
Зарегистрирован: 14/09/2017 11:01:56
Сообщений: 4
Оффлайн
|
nsnt wrote:
AlKuz wrote:Здравствуйте!
Помогите пожалуйста разобраться с проблемой. При отправке запроса на регистрацию результатов инвентаризации получаю ошибку: "Запрос должен содержать заявку". Примеры запроса и ответа во вложении. Работаю с тестовой системой. С api@vetrf.ru никакого ответа так и не получил, поэтому пишу сюда.
Возможно, потому что в stockDiscrepancy/resultingList/stockEntry требуется указать uuid, а не guid.
Спасибо, исправил, но это не помогло - ошибка та же. Такое ощущение, что он не видит элемента resolveDiscrepancyRequest, потому что такая же ошибка появляется, если оставить app:data пустым.
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 14/09/2017 15:56:45
|
nsnt
Зарегистрирован: 31/05/2017 09:06:10
Сообщений: 242
Оффлайн
|
AlKuz wrote:
nsnt wrote:
AlKuz wrote:Здравствуйте!
Помогите пожалуйста разобраться с проблемой. При отправке запроса на регистрацию результатов инвентаризации получаю ошибку: "Запрос должен содержать заявку". Примеры запроса и ответа во вложении. Работаю с тестовой системой. С api@vetrf.ru никакого ответа так и не получил, поэтому пишу сюда.
Возможно, потому что в stockDiscrepancy/resultingList/stockEntry требуется указать uuid, а не guid.
Спасибо, исправил, но это не помогло - ошибка та же. Такое ощущение, что он не видит элемента resolveDiscrepancyRequest, потому что такая же ошибка появляется, если оставить app:data пустым.
У меня тоже ощущение, что не видит, но причина непонятна, на вид все нормально. Зато еще нашла разницу с рабочим запросом - stockDiscrepancy и discrepancyReport относятся к http://api.vetrf.ru/schema/cdm/mercury/vet-document, а в примере справки http://api.vetrf.ru/schema/cdm/mercury/applications, не знаю, влияет или нет. И у unit тоже надо uuid, а не guid, но это уж точно не влияет.
Это сообщение было редактировано 3 раз. Последнее обновление произошло в 14/09/2017 16:12:26
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 14/09/2017 17:00:18
|
AlKuz
Зарегистрирован: 14/09/2017 11:01:56
Сообщений: 4
Оффлайн
|
Поменял пространство имен для stockDiscrepancy и discrepancyReport и у unit заменил Guid на Uuid - результата не принесло, все еще ошибка.
Имя файла |
InventoryRequest.txt |
Загрузить
|
Описание |
|
Размер файла |
3 Kbytes
|
Скачано: |
495 раз |
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 15/09/2017 09:32:02
|
nifor
![[Avatar]](/vetrf-forum/images/avatar/a17479231dc298309a3fda7d7d00111a.jpg)
Зарегистрирован: 21/04/2017 04:01:50
Сообщений: 150
Оффлайн
|
http://help.vetrf.ru/wiki/ResolveDiscrepancyOperation#.D0.9E.D0.B1.D1.8A.D0.B5.D0.BA.D1.82_..Request.2FstockDiscrepancy.2FresultingList
Вот это поле попробуйте заполнить
Response/stockEntryList/stockEntry/vetDocument - UUID нужен
Объект содержит сведения о ветеринарно-сопроводительном документе.
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 15/09/2017 11:48:24
|
AlKuz
Зарегистрирован: 14/09/2017 11:01:56
Сообщений: 4
Оффлайн
|
Привел запрос к следующему виду (во вложении), и все заработало. Пришлось явно указать пространства имен для submitApplicationRequest, application и resolveDiscrepancyRequest.
Спасибо за помощь.
Имя файла |
InventoryRequest.txt |
Загрузить
|
Описание |
|
Размер файла |
3 Kbytes
|
Скачано: |
521 раз |
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 15/09/2017 14:16:30
|
wolfenstein66
Зарегистрирован: 15/09/2017 14:15:07
Сообщений: 1
Оффлайн
|
Здравствуйте!
Когда стартует шлюз версии 2? Хотя бы тестовый.
Дело в том что в тестируемом 1.4 в справочнике наименований продукции отсутствуют Упаковки, GLN и штриходы продукта.
Версия 1.3-1.4 однозначно не подходит, интеграция приостановлена. Вокруг запуска 2.0 ходят темные слухи, пролейте пожалуйста свет на эту тайну
Это сообщение было редактировано 1 раз. Последнее обновление произошло в 15/09/2017 14:19:39
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 15/09/2017 14:25:44
|
nsnt
Зарегистрирован: 31/05/2017 09:06:10
Сообщений: 242
Оффлайн
|
AlKuz wrote:Привел запрос к следующему виду (во вложении), и все заработало. Пришлось явно указать пространства имен для submitApplicationRequest, application и resolveDiscrepancyRequest.
Спасибо за помощь.
Вот она, ошибка!
xmlns:app="http://api.vetrf.ru/schema/cdm/application/ws-definitions".
Надо "http://api.vetrf.ru/schema/cdm/application".
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 18/09/2017 14:24:52
|
Yoreg07
Зарегистрирован: 21/07/2016 06:41:02
Сообщений: 573
Оффлайн
|
wolfenstein66 wrote:Здравствуйте!
Когда стартует шлюз версии 2? Хотя бы тестовый.
Дело в том что в тестируемом 1.4 в справочнике наименований продукции отсутствуют Упаковки, GLN и штриходы продукта.
Версия 1.3-1.4 однозначно не подходит, интеграция приостановлена. Вокруг запуска 2.0 ходят темные слухи, пролейте пожалуйста свет на эту тайну
Присоединяюсь к вопросу.
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 18/09/2017 16:05:35
|
Денис Сергеевич
Зарегистрирован: 11/08/2017 13:31:41
Сообщений: 216
Оффлайн
|
Добрый день!
Есть ли какой-нибудь дополнительный способ узнать GUID код площадки контрагента,помимо
скачивания файла со страницы выбора обслуживаемого предприятия?
Спасибо!
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 18/09/2017 19:05:55
|
Vesta_IT
Зарегистрирован: 16/09/2017 15:07:38
Сообщений: 61
Оффлайн
|
Yoreg07 wrote:
wolfenstein66 wrote:Здравствуйте!
Когда стартует шлюз версии 2? Хотя бы тестовый.
Дело в том что в тестируемом 1.4 в справочнике наименований продукции отсутствуют Упаковки, GLN и штриходы продукта.
Версия 1.3-1.4 однозначно не подходит, интеграция приостановлена. Вокруг запуска 2.0 ходят темные слухи, пролейте пожалуйста свет на эту тайну
Присоединяюсь к вопросу.
неистово присоединяемся - можно ли разрабатывать под версию 2.0 сразу? По срокам вроде на тестовом контуре уже должно работать?
я правильно понимаю, что для "Подсистема работы со справочниками и реестрами" - разницы нет- есть только одна версия сервисов?
и версионирование касается только ассинхронных операций в "Подсистема обработки заявок в Ветис.API"
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 18/09/2017 19:21:28
|
nsnt
Зарегистрирован: 31/05/2017 09:06:10
Сообщений: 242
Оффлайн
|
Vesta_IT wrote:
Yoreg07 wrote:
wolfenstein66 wrote:Здравствуйте!
Когда стартует шлюз версии 2? Хотя бы тестовый.
Дело в том что в тестируемом 1.4 в справочнике наименований продукции отсутствуют Упаковки, GLN и штриходы продукта.
Версия 1.3-1.4 однозначно не подходит, интеграция приостановлена. Вокруг запуска 2.0 ходят темные слухи, пролейте пожалуйста свет на эту тайну
Присоединяюсь к вопросу.
неистово присоединяемся - можно ли разрабатывать под версию 2.0 сразу? По срокам вроде на тестовом контуре уже должно работать?
я правильно понимаю, что для "Подсистема работы со справочниками и реестрами" - разницы нет- есть только одна версия сервисов?
и версионирование касается только ассинхронных операций в "Подсистема обработки заявок в Ветис.API"
В этой ветке обсуждают:
http://vetrf.ru/vetrf-forum/posts/list/7130.page
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 21/09/2017 09:05:38
|
Yoreg07
Зарегистрирован: 21/07/2016 06:41:02
Сообщений: 573
Оффлайн
|
Всем добрый день. Скажите работает сейчас https://api2.vetrf.ru:8002/platform/services/ProductService ... а то у меня 500-ая ошибка сыпется
|
|
 |
![[Post New]](/vetrf-forum/templates/default/images/icon_minipost_new.gif) 21/09/2017 13:27:59
|
Yoreg07
Зарегистрирован: 21/07/2016 06:41:02
Сообщений: 573
Оффлайн
|
Отбой .. сам накосячил
Другой вопрос: ProductItem - это наименование в номенклатуре производителя, так? Если имеется два абсолютно одинаковых товара, но произведённых в разных местах, то это будут два разных ProductItem? или при запросе списка ProductItemList по SubProduct и EnterpiseGUID по этим двум производителям оба ответа будут содержать один и тот же ProductItem.GUID ?
|
|
 |
|